Carbon fiber center console
By 88TSI_Rob,
Here is a pic of my center console. I needed a way to cleanly house my gauge display and a couple of other things so I built this out of a sheet of CF.
http://snipurl.com/4xfe
I purchased the 11" x 8" x 0.032" sheet of CF from www.robotmarketplace.com. I was extremely impressed with the piece I got from them.
